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 400°F. Line a baking sheet with a sheet of Reynolds Kitchens Brown Parchment Paper Roll. Lay out bacon strips in a single layer and bake for 15–18 minutes, or until crisp. Drain on a paper towel.
- While the bacon cooks, wash and dry the lettuce and slice the tomato using the Mueller Pro-Series 10-in-1, 8 Blade Vegetable Chopper for uniformity.
- Toast bread slices in a SENSARTE Nonstick Frying Pan Skillet over medium heat, just until golden.
- Spread mayonnaise on one side of each toasted bread slice. Season tomato slices lightly with salt and black pepper.
- Layer your sandwich: start with lettuce, then tomato, and top with 4 bacon slices per sandwich. Add optional avocado, cheese, or egg as desired. Finish with the second slice of bread.
- Cut the sandwich in half, serve immediately, and enjoy while warm.
Cook and Prep Times
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 18 minutes
Total Time: 28 minutes
